Radiology Technologist / Scrub Tech
Join our dynamic healthcare team as an X-Ray Technologist / Scrub Tech, where your expertise will play a vital role in delivering high-quality patient care and supporting our surgical and diagnostic procedures. We are committed to fostering a collaborative and innovative environment that values professional growth and excellence in patient outcomes.
Key Responsibilities:
- Prepare and position patients for Angio procedures to ensure optimal imaging and safety.
- Operate fluoroscopy machine in accordance with safety protocols.
- Assist surgeons and medical staff during operative procedures by maintaining a sterile environment and providing necessary instruments and supplies.
- Maintain accurate patient records and ensure proper documentation of procedures performed.
- Adhere to all safety, infection control, and confidentiality policies to protect patients and staff.
- Perform routine equipment checks and troubleshoot technical issues to ensure optimal functioning.
- Collaborate with healthcare team members to deliver comprehensive patient care.
- Assist with Inventory Management
Skills and Qualifications:
- Graduate of accredited X-ray technician/technologist program with State of Oregon License
- Prior experience in radiology, surgical assisting, or scrub tech roles preferred
- Knowledge of radiologic procedures, surgical protocols, and sterile techniques.
- Strong attention to detail and excellent manual dexterity.
- Ability to work effectively in high-pressure environments and as part of a team.
- Good communication skills and compassionate patient care approach.
- Sufficient knowledge of human anatomy and physiology to identify area for radiology
